Quote from HomeFlipper on August 11, 2020, 4:10 pmSo, when I moved into my new home, I noticed that there were still some things from the previous owner there. Namely, the brackets for the blinds that I assume went with them. Do I need to replace these brackets? Or can I use them for the blinds I have? Thanks for the help ahead of time!

Quote from BobbiJ on August 18, 2020, 1:14 pmIf your blinds are the same size and color you can use them. Most blinds come with their own hardware though. I would probably change them out to match what you are putting up (plus the new ones will look new).
